在正则表达式中 findall的作用是?python正则表达式re.findall(r
本篇文章给大家谈谈在正则表达式中 findall的作用是,以及python正则表达式re.findall(r\对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
一、python正则表达式re.findall(r\
1、findall是返回所匹配的字符串,返回的是一个列表,并不返回match对象,match对象才有start,span方法
2、matchs=re.finditer(r'\w+',"Thisisatest")
3、print(match.start(),match.span())
4、想找到所有匹配字符串的索引用finditer吧
二、find函数提取文本中的数字
1、find函数不能直接提取文本中的数字。find函数是用于查找字符串中某个子字符串的位置,返回的是该子字符串在原字符串中的索引值。
2、如果要提取文本中的数字,可以使用正则表达式来匹配数字模式,或者使用字符串的split函数将字符串按照数字分隔成多个字符串,再逐一判断每个字符串是否为数字。
3、此外,还可以使用Python内置的isdigit方法判断一个字符串是否为数字,然后将符合条件的字符串提取出来。总之,提取文本中的数字需要使用多种方法和技巧,需要根据具体的情况进行选择和调整。
好了,文章到此结束,希望可以帮助到大家。
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- 在正则表达式中 g表示什么,正则表达式中i,g,ig,gi,m的区别和含义 2023-11-29
- 在正则表达式中 findall的作用是?python正则表达式re.findall(r 2023-11-29
- 在正则表达式中 d代表什么?正则表达式^和$有什么用 2023-11-29
- 在正则表达式中 d代表什么意思(正则表达式@) 2023-11-29
- 在正则表达式中 d代表什么()(正则表达式(d+g,) 2023-11-29
- 在正则表达式 中文字符(oracle正则表达式查询value中只包含任何中文和数字的记录) 2023-11-29